10000 feet - a bird's eye view. So what is the movie about?
This is a movie primarily made in Tamil and then dubbed into Hindi and Telugu. So if you do understand Tamil, you are lucky to see this movie in its main language.. If not, its still ok. You can see this movie in Hindi or Telugu. You will not get the same feel.. as some of the dialogues are Tamil specific and you understand that when they do not have the effect when delivered in Hindi. But, the concept, visual brilliance, music and screen presence is language independent and you can enjoy the same irrespective of whether you watch in Tamil or Hindi..
The movie is about a inventor/scientist - Dr. Vaseegaran. He is making a robot which will be used for the good of Indian Armed services. But things go wrong when he tries to enhance it above the limit set by nature. It is the story about, how when man made things threaten the very existence of its creator. The story has a great moral which strikes hard only after watching the whole movie, So I will not reveal it and steal that thunder.
